We drove from Death Valley right to Vegas, the first thing we saw was the impressive beam of light from the Luxor surrounded by the glittering city of Las Vegas. It looked ridiculously impressive by night.


On day one we headed to the Jean Philippe Patisserie in the Bellagio for breakfast and gazed in awe at the worlds largest chocolate fountain.


Somehow we found ourselves in an aquatic exhibition in the middle of the Bellagio, made entirely out of flowers.
Time to head out! We ventured down the strip going in every single casino Vegas had to offer, first was the cosmopolitan, home of a restaurant inside a chandelier! Then New York New York, were we found a great Irish pub.

We ventured in and explored a lot that day, even seeing the Jubilee Theatre. (Such a shame about that show ending.)

At the end of day one we went to see Cirque Du Solei’s O. It was absolutely breathtaking. The stunts were wild, the clowns were hilarious, the use of water in the entire show was spectacular!
